Overview Of Costs
The upfront price of a soldering gun depends on wattage, heat control, and build quality. Basic models start around 10 to 25 dollars and can reach 30 dollars at the high end. Mid range devices commonly cost 35 to 60 dollars, with professional items often 90 to 140 dollars or more. For durability and frequent use, plan for about 60 to 150 dollars for a solid setup that includes a few replacement tips. Assumptions: consumer grade, home or hobby use, standard 120 V supply.

What Drives Price
Price variation follows several factors. Wattage and heat control are primary; higher wattage supports faster heating and steady temperature, which costs more. Tip compatibility expands as a model gains more tip types and sizes, increasing value but also cost.
Other drivers include build quality and ergonomics. A robust handle, secure temperature regulation and faster recovery times add cost but reduce long term wear and downtime. Warranty length and included accessories also shift price. If a kit includes a stand, reel of solder, and assorted tips, upfront costs rise but integrated value improves.
Regional price differences matter. In urban centers, tax and shipping may push price up by 5% to 12% relative to rural areas. Seasonal sales and promotions can temporarily trim price by 10% to 25% on mid to high end models.
Ways To Save
Smart buyers balance need against cost. Consider these approaches to control expenditure without sacrificing reliability. Choose a model with just enough heat control for the task and add upgrades later if needed.
Shop bundles that include a starter tip set and a stand; these often deliver lower total price than buying items separately. Compare a few reputable brands known for durability, and verify the tip assortment covers common tasks such as lead-free soldering and delicate electronics. Check warranty terms to ensure coverage for the first year of use.

Hidden Costs and Add-Ons
Hidden costs include taxes, shipping, and occasional disposal fees for hazardous waste such as flux and spent tips. Some models require specialty tips that are not cross compatible with other brands, which can raise ongoing costs. A basic kit with a few essential tips may be cheaper initially but lead to higher per-task costs if replacements are frequent. Account for these when budgeting.
